The Straw Hats visits an island, known as Mecha Island, where a fisherman sings an old folk song about a Golden Crown. Searching for that mysterious treasure, they find a hidden entrance into the island. The island's leader, Ratchet, impressed with the find and in search of the Golden Crown himself, invites the crew to join him in his search and the crew along with Ratchet and his henchmen enter the cave. As it turns out, the islands true form, is that of a giant turtle. Ratchet, who had known this all along, uses his mechanical castle to take control of the turtle, in order to use it, to take over the world. Now the Straw Hats have to stop not only Ratchet, but also the helpless turtle, from crashing into a nearby island.

Plot Summary

The Straw Hat Pirates arrive on an island in search of a legendary treasure, only to find themselves caught in the middle of a battle involving a giant, ancient robot. Luffy and his crew must figure out how to stop the rampaging mecha and uncover the secrets of the island before it's too late. Along the way, they encounter new allies and face formidable challenges that test their strength and unity.
